Taking out drive shafts for tranny swap. and I dont have a socket big enough for the axle nut. I plan on doing this today and well I need to know what size socket to buy, don't have the money to buy a full large size set atm. so just need the size? 92 Leg L sedan (not that I dont think that matters) THANKS!

Yes, 32mm. The older ones (GL models) used a 36mm on the end of the axle shafts.
